# HG changeset patch # User Hans-G?nter Theisgen # Date 1660320459 -3600 # Node ID 7c489c2896a98e8bb263fd0eb45f685e6f3dd60f # Parent 0a278b5f18cab44f061266755c9ea098c0610d86 copied recipes for libffi and libffi-dev from cooking wok diff -r 0a278b5f18ca -r 7c489c2896a9 audacity/receipt --- a/audacity/receipt Sun Aug 07 10:11:10 2022 +0100 +++ b/audacity/receipt Fri Aug 12 17:07:39 2022 +0100 @@ -53,4 +53,3 @@ cp -a $install/usr/share/pixmaps $fs/usr/share cp -a $install/usr/share/applications $fs/usr/share } - diff -r 0a278b5f18ca -r 7c489c2896a9 libffi-dev/receipt --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/libffi-dev/receipt Fri Aug 12 17:07:39 2022 +0100 @@ -0,0 +1,20 @@ +# SliTaz package receipt. + +PACKAGE="libffi-dev" +VERSION="3.4.2" +CATEGORY="development" +SHORT_DESC="Libffi, development files." +MAINTAINER="rcx@zoominternet.net" +LICENSE="MIT" +WEB_SITE="https://sourceware.org/libffi/" + +DEPENDS="libffi pkg-config" +WANTED="libffi" + +HOST_ARCH="i486 arm" + +# Rules to gen a SliTaz package suitable for Tazpkg. +genpkg_rules() +{ + get_dev_files +} diff -r 0a278b5f18ca -r 7c489c2896a9 libffi/receipt ---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/libffi/receipt Fri Aug 12 17:07:39 2022 +0100 @@ -0,0 +1,38 @@ +# SliTaz package receipt. + +PACKAGE="libffi" +VERSION="3.4.2" +CATEGORY="development" +SHORT_DESC="A portable foreign function interface library." +MAINTAINER="rcx@zoominternet.net" +LICENSE="MIT" +WEB_SITE="https://sourceware.org/libffi/" + +TARBALL="$PACKAGE-$VERSION.tar.gz" +WGET_URL="https://github.com/$PACKAGE/$PACKAGE/releases/download/v$VERSION/$TARBALL" + +DEPENDS="glibc-base" + +HOST_ARCH="i486 arm" + +current_version() +{ + wget -O - $WEB_SITE 2>/dev/null | \ + sed "/$PACKAGE-/!d;/tar/!d;s|.*$PACKAGE-\\(.*\\).tar.*\".*|\\1|;q" +} + +# Rules to configure and make the package. +compile_rules() +{ + ./configure \ + --includedir=/usr/include \ + $CONFIGURE_ARGS && + make && + make install DESTDIR=$DESTDIR +} + +# Rules to gen a SliTaz package suitable for Tazpkg. +genpkg_rules() +{ + cook_copy_files *.so* +}